Programme Java pour calculer une remise de 5% pour un achat supérieur à 5000
Obtenez le prix et la quantité d'un produit, calculez le montant de la facture et calculez 5 % de réduction pour le montant de la facture de 5 000 et plus.
Exemple d'entrée 1 :
10 400
Exemple de sortie 1 :
4 000
Exemple d'entrée 2 :
20 500
Exemple de sortie 2 :
9 500
Conception d'organigramme
Programme ou solution
import java.util.*;
class Discount
{
public static void main(String args[])
{
double quantity,price,amount,discount;
Scanner sc=new Scanner(System.in);
System.out.println("Enter The Price Of The Product:");
price=sc.nextDouble();
System.out.println("Enter The No Of Quantity:");
quantity=sc.nextDouble();
amount=quantity*price;
if(amount>5000)
{
discount=amount*0.05;
amount=amount-discount;
}
System.out.println("The Total Amount is:"+amount);
}
}
Explication du programme
1. Obtenez deux entrées de quantité et de prix de la part de l'utilisateur à l'aide de la classe scanner
2. Calculez le montant en utilisant l'expression montant =quantité * prix
3. Vérifiez si le montant est supérieur à 5000 en utilisant l'instruction if.
si le montant est supérieur à 5 000, calculez la remise et le montant à l'aide des expressions
3a. remise =montant * 0,05
3b. montant =montant - remise
4. montant d'impression en utilisant system.out.println
3a et 3b seront exécutés si 3 renvoie vrai sinon ces deux ne seront pas exécutés.